Quote by Ovid

If you wish to marry suitably, marry your equal.


If you wish to marry suitably, marry your equal.

Summary

This quote suggests that in order to have a successful and fulfilling marriage, it is important to choose a partner who is on the same level as you. It advises against marrying someone who is significantly different from you in terms of social class, education, or other important aspects of life. The idea behind this is that when two individuals are equals, they are likely to have a better understanding of each other's needs, aspirations, and values, creating a stronger foundation for a harmonious and balanced relationship.
